Festive Turkey Trot Event at Avila Beach

The annual “Turkey Trot on the Water” took place recently at Avila Beach, drawing a crowd eager to celebrate the Thanksgiving season with a unique twist on the traditional run. Participants enjoyed a scenic route along the waterfront, combining fitness with festivities in a picturesque coastal setting.

Event Highlights and Community Involvement

This year’s Turkey Trot featured various activities, including a fun run and a walk, allowing individuals of all ages to participate. Local vendors set up booths, offering refreshments and holiday-themed goods, enhancing the community atmosphere. Families and friends gathered to enjoy the event, making it a perfect pre-Thanksgiving celebration.

What’s New and What’s Next

  • The event attracted a larger turnout compared to previous years, indicating growing community interest.
  • Local businesses reported increased sales during the event, benefiting from the influx of visitors.
  • Organizers plan to expand the event next year, potentially adding more activities and entertainment options.

The Turkey Trot on the Water not only promotes health and wellness but also fosters community spirit as residents come together to kick off the holiday season. As the event continues to grow, it remains a cherished tradition for many in the Central Coast area.
